The Analysis of Polysaccharides Present in Glycosylated Proteins

While the majority of reported work concerning the sequencing of biomolecules by LC-MS has involved proteins, important information may also be obtained from oligosaccharides by employing a similar methodology to that described previously. [Pg.177]

The study of sulfated standards enabled certain structural features to be associated with particular ions that appeared in their negative-ion electrospray MS-MS spectra. The following is reproduced from this paper [23]  [Pg.177]

It was also noted that ions at m/z 180 and m/z 513, associated with the attachment of sulfate to C-3 of GlcNAc and C-4 of GalNAc, found in the FAB MS-MS spectra, were also observed in electrospray MS-MS spectra but were of low abundance. [Pg.177]

GalNAc, Gal, GlcNAc, Hex and HexNAc are the abbreviations used when discussing sequences of monosaccharides and represent A-acetylgalactosamine, galactose, N-acctylglucosamine, hexose, i.e. a monosaccharide with six carbon atoms, and N-acctylhcxosamine, respectively. [Pg.177]
